#fe4d50 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#fe4d50 is composed of 99.6% red, 30.2% green and 31.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 69.7% magenta, 68.5% yellow and 0.4% black. It has a hue angle of 359 degrees, a saturation of 98.9% and a lightness of 64.9%. #fe4d50 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ff9aa0 with #fd0000. Closest websafe color is: #ff6666.

#fe4d50 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#fe4d50 has RGB values of R:254, G:77, B:80 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.7, Y:0.69, K:0. Its decimal value is 16665936.

Shades and Tints of #fe4d50
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#110000 is the darkest color, while #fffdfd is the lightest one.

Tones of #fe4d50
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#aba0a0 is the less saturated color, while #fe4d50 is the most saturated one.
